- [ ] Review timezone handling in the Quillreach report exporter before key material is committed. All export timestamps must be normalized to UTC at the serialization boundary, never in the query layer. Check that the Ostervale fiscal-week rollup does not double-apply the tenant offset — this bit us in the last ceremony dry run. Reviewer signs off only after the golden exports diff clean across three zones. Sign-off unlocks the export signing key, whose recovery passphrase is recorded below.

strongbox words: jorix-norys-aldius-druax

## Support

The Ovenbird service enforces the bakery's order-cutoff rule: orders after 15:30 local roll to the next delivery day. If on-call gets paged, it's usually a timezone drift between the cutoff config and the store clock — check `cutoff.yaml` first. Overrides exist but require a logged reason. Do not hand-edit the schedule table. For rule changes or unexplained rollovers, escalate here.

escalation mailbox, bafog-fafog: ulador@paliqlabs.internal

Subject: Quickstore 4.2 — bloom filter now fronts the KV layer

Plugin authors: starting with this release, Quickstore places a bloom filter ahead of the key-value store. Negative lookups return faster; false positives fall through safely. No API changes are required on your side. Verify your plugin against the staging build referenced below.

session token of fahif-tadup = htk3_9c7